Not to revive a thread, but for collective record... I checked with Paul Stuart on the Madrid... Made by Martegani with Blake construction.

Paul Stuart seems to have moved to an always-having-a-sale strategy. They were having their semi-annual sale and then they moved to their President's Day sale and next up will probably be an Arbor Day sale. This is not usually a good sign, but I've been worrying about Paul Stuart's viability for years, and they're still around, selling very good quality merchandise, for the most part. And there are some pretty good deals. I believe someone said these adelaides are C&J. If so, pretty good deal
